Bengaluru, Karnataka, IND
1 day ago
Automation Engineer

Quantum delivers end-to-end data management solutions designed for the AI era. With over four decades of experience, our data platform has allowed customers to extract the maximum value from their unique, unstructured data. From high-performance ingest that powers AI applications and demanding data-intensive workloads, to massive, durable data lakes to fuel AI models, Quantum delivers the most comprehensive and cost-efficient solutions. Leading organizations in life sciences, government, media and entertainment, research, and industrial technology trust Quantum with their most valuable asset – their data. Quantum is listed on Nasdaq (QMCO). For more information visit www.quantum.com.

Job Summary and Duties:

The primary focus of this role as an Automation Engineer is the development and maintenance of automated testing, and deployment solutions as part of product serving the expanding scale-out file and object storage market.

Responsibilities:

Develop infrastructure and framework for the engineering organization to write and execute automated testing. This is primarily a phyton framework running in containers on Linux. Work with a high performing Agile/iterative team to develop cutting edge solutions in test and deployment engineering. Work closely with Software Engineering and Product team in the development of toolsets to help harden Quality Engineering and Development Engineering testing as well as release management. Collaborate with internal and external stakeholders or partners to gather and compose requirements for automation. Write and develop unit and system/integration test cases for the framework. Maintain proficiency with products under test to create the best-automated tests and tools. Triage and root cause analysis.

Job Requirements:

Bachelor’s degree in computer science or a related field, or equivalent experience. 2+ years of experience with scripting and automation using Python, Bash, or similar languages. Strong working knowledge of Linux (macOS or Windows experience is a plus). Experience with distributed version control systems like GitHub or GitLab. Familiarity with container technologies (Docker, Kubernetes) is a plus. Hands-on experience with automated testing and deployment tools such as Ansible or Selenium. Understanding of RESTful APIs (GraphQL experience is a plus). Experience working within an Agile development environment. Experience with Storage product and protocols like NFS, SMB is a plus
Por favor confirme su dirección de correo electrónico: Send Email